  PCST Swimmers Compete in Auburn Seventeen members of the Panama City Swim Team Tsunamis traveled to Auburn, Alabama this past weekend to compete in the War Eagle Invitational Swim Meet on the campus of Auburn University.  The meet featured more than 450 swimmers representing 22 teams from Alabama, Florida, Mississippi, Georgia, and New Jersey. Congratulations to PCST swimmers listed below who had tremendous individual accomplishments in Auburn. Three PCST Swimmers Named to SES All Star Teams! Three PCST swimmers have been named as members of the 2011-2012 Southeastern Swimming LSC Age Group All Star Team.  Tsunamis Marisa Ashley, Kari Troia, and Tristan Gandy earned the honor due to their efforts in the pool last season.  Marisa was the only PCST swimmer to earn the honor in both the Short Course and Long Course seasons, while Kari and Tristan qualified in the Short Course Season.  Less than 200 swimmers receive the All-Star designation each season out of nearly...
